Chief Diagnostic Radiographer Grade 1 (Nuclear Medicine)
  Employment Type: Permanent
  Reference No: GSH81/2021
  Groote Schuur Hospital, Observatory
 
Experience:
A minimum of 3 years’ appropriate experience as a Radiographer (Nuclear Medicine) after registration with the HPCSA.
 
Minimum educational qualification:
Appropriate qualification that allows for registration with the Health Professions Council of South Africa (HPCSA) as a Radiographer (Nuclear Medicine).
 
Duties (key result areas/outputs):
Be responsible for the control, supervision, delegation, and co-ordination of activities in the department and the delivery of a professional service to patients. Produce diagnostic images of high quality and be responsible for staff and student training in your area. Participate in the management of the cost centre (ordering of radiopharmaceuticals, radioisotopes, and general consumables). Ensure quality assurance, maintenance of equipment and the purchase, use and care of suitable radiation protection equipment. Participate in middle management and delegated management tasks, including statistic collation and provide support to the Head of department.

Inherent requirement of the job:
Must be able to manage and supervise a subsection of the department with knowledge, experience, and skills in general imaging, positron emission tomography, in vitro techniques, theranostics and PACS. Must be able to do on call duty as required.

Competencies (knowledge/skills):
Sound knowledge of radiation protection, quality assurance and equipment safety pertaining to Nuclear Medicine. Computer literate and communicate in at least two of the three official languages of the Western Cape (written and verbal). Knowledge of Patient Archiving and Communication Systems with good administrative, supervisory, and managerial skills.
